What was perhaps the last World Cup match for Cristiano Ronaldo ended in tears after Portugal was eliminated from the tournament in Qatar with a 1–0 loss to Morocco in the quarterfinals on Saturday. Morocco became the first African country in the history of the men’s World Cup to make the semifinals and just the third team outside of Europe or South America to make the final four.
